Troops Renovate Nagathampiran Kovil Road on Request of Kovil Committee

On 09 February 2023, troops from 10 (V) Vijayabahu Infantry Regiment of 553 Infantry Brigade under command to 55 Infantry Division of the Security Forces Headquarters - Jaffna assisted in the renovation of the Nagathampiran Kovil road. The deteriorating road provided access to the ancient Nagathampiran Kovil and Nagarkovil village of Vadamarachchi - East Divisional Secretariate. On the request of the Kovil Committee, the Commanding Officer of 10 (V) Vijayabahu Infantry Regiment, Major KHC Samanpriya directed the troops to launch this community project under the guidance of the Commander of the 553 Infantry Brigade, Colonel Janak Premathilake. Troops of the 553 Infantry Brigade and the 10 (V) Vijayabahu Infantry Regiment, Grama Niladhari of Nagarkovil (South), members of the Nagathampiran Kovil committee and civilians in the area participated in the programme.

Distribution of Blazers to School Prefects in Line with 75th Independence Day Celebrations in 55 Infantry Division

Distribution of 35 number of Blazers to school Prefects had taken place in a charming ceremony held in line with 75th Independence Day ceremonies of 55 Infantry Division on 02nd February 2023. 18 x Prefects from Ceylon Catholic Tamil Mixed School, Kovilvayal and 17 x Prefects from Roman Catholic Tamil Mixed School, Pulopallai were benefited. Major General Prasanna Gunaratne, the General Officer Commanding 55 Infantry Division, had led the effort to great success.

75th Independence Day Celebrations in Point Pedro

On 04th February 2023, 55 Infantry Division joined in celebrating the 75th Independence Day by conducting a series of programmes at Colins Ground Nelliadi in Point Pedro, one of the most populous regions in Jaffna Peninsula. Within the overall concept of the President, Ranil Wickremesinghe, to mark the 75th independence across the country, celebrations in Jaffna are predominantly significant in terms of national peace and harmony. This was the first time in modern history that an Independence Day celebration was held in the Jaffna Peninsula.

Security Forces (Jaffna) Releases 80 Acres of Civilian Land in Jaffna

In consistent with the government policy of releasing northern lands, hitherto used by the Security Forces to their original owners, the Security Forces Headquarters (Jaffna), in coinciding with the 75th Independence Day, on the instructions of Honourable President Ranil Wickremesinghe, and with the guidance of the Defence Secretary and the Commander of the Army, released 80 acres of land in Kankasanthurai, Mailaddy and Anthanipuram areas under Thelippalai Divisional Secretariat to their original owners on 03rd February 2023 during a special ceremony.
